As per the MHCA 2017, the patients are not entitled to get the collateral data entered in their medical data. Collateral information is the data (personal, electronic, telephonic, and so forth.) or records offered by the members of the family, family members, caregivers, NRs, neighbors, colleagues, employees, police, medical board members, and henceforth. Regularly, the sufferers aren't in a place to provide an appropriate history as a end result of ongoing psychiatric sickness. Hence, an try ought to be made to doc such information separately. The MHP has the right to restrict the release of such information with justification, whenever requested by the patient.
